Piotr Mulawka Leksykon polskiej i światowej muzyki elektronicznej „Zrealizowano w ramach programu stypendialnego Ministra Kultury i Dziedzictwa Narodowego-Kultura w sieci” Wydawca: Piotr Mulawka [email protected] © 2020 Wszelkie prawa zastrzeżone ISBN 978-83-943331-4-0 2 Przedmowa Muzyka elektroniczna narodziła się w latach 50-tych XX wieku, a do jej powstania przyczyniły się zdobycze techniki z końca XIX wieku m.in. telefon- pierwsze urządzenie służące do przesyłania dźwięków na odległość (Aleksander Graham Bell), fonograf- pierwsze urządzenie zapisujące dźwięk (Thomas Alv Edison 1877), gramofon (Emile Berliner 1887). Jak podają źródła, w 1948 roku francuski badacz, kompozytor, akustyk Pierre Schaeffer (1910-1995) nagrał za pomocą mikrofonu dźwięki naturalne m.in. (śpiew ptaków, hałas uliczny, rozmowy) i próbował je przekształcać. Tak powstała muzyka nazwana konkretną (fr. musigue concrete). W tym samym roku wyemitował w radiu „Koncert szumów”. Jego najważniejszą kompozycją okazał się utwór pt. „Symphonie pour un homme seul” z 1950 roku. W kolejnych latach muzykę konkretną łączono z muzyką tradycyjną. Oto pionierzy tego eksperymentu: John Cage i Yannis Xenakis. Muzyka konkretna pojawiła się w kompozycji Rogera Watersa. Utwór ten trafił na ścieżkę dźwiękową do filmu „The Body” (1970). Grupa Beaver and Krause wprowadziła muzykę konkretną do utworu „Walking Green Algae Blues” z albumu „In A Wild Sanctuary” (1970), a zespół Pink Floyd w „Animals” (1977). Pierwsze próby tworzenia muzyki elektronicznej miały miejsce w Darmstadt (w Niemczech) na Międzynarodowych Kursach Nowej Muzyki w 1950 roku. W 1951 roku powstało pierwsze studio muzyki elektronicznej przy Rozgłośni Radia Zachodnioniemieckiego w Kolonii (NWDR- Nordwestdeutscher Rundfunk). Tu tworzyli: H. Eimert (Glockenspiel 1953), K. The StarGazer http://www.raclub.org/ Newsletter of the Rappahannock Astronomy Club No. 4, Vol. 3 February 2015–April 2015 Celebrating the Hubble Space Telescope’s 25th Anniversary by David Abbou When Galileo first turned a telescope toward the heavens more than 400 years ago, a new revolution in astronomy was born. Then, 25 years ago, a new chapter in astronomy began with the deployment of the Hubble Space Telescope (HST). While the HST is very well known to most everyone, its beginnings read more like a rag-to-riches story. When the HST was first deployed in 1990, its images of the heavens were blurred because of defects in its mirror. As a result, NASA became the butt of many jokes as the $1.5 billion telescope seemed doomed and useless. HST Pillars of Creation Then and Now. Source: http://www.nasa.gov/sites/default/files/p1501ay.jpg However, as with challenges it faced before, NASA rose to the occasion to devise a solution, and a servicing mission was scheduled to correct HST’s mirror. In late 1993, astronauts aboard the space shuttle successfully repaired HST high above Earth’s surface, and like a nearsighted human who sees the world with glasses for the first time, HST’s vision became crisp and sharp. I remember when one of its many images caught the attention of the world in 1995. This image of a portion of the M16 nebula titled “Pillars of Creation” appeared in newspapers, magazines, and television news stories worldwide. Just the year before, the HST reminded us of how vulnerable we were to collisions from asteroids and comets with its images of Jupiter after the Comet Shoemaker-Levy impacts. -
